<description>I've spent a lot of time talking about our comprehensive plan to diversify Michigan's economy - especially our "Go Anywhere Do Anything" approach to attracting and growing good-paying jobs in fields like life sciences, homeland security and alternative energy. 

Well, I want to tell you that one of the things that we're also doing as part of our plan is to build on our past successes in the auto industry to create a new advanced automotive industry right here in Michigan.
